    We applied for Health in Pregnancy Grant a few weeks back. At my girlfriend's 25 week Midwife appointment the Midwife signed the form and gave it to us. We posted it about two weeks later (after start of April). We received a letter yesterday saying that it could not be paid because it was signed by the Midwife before gf was 25 weeks pregnant. This confused us because the Midwife signed it on the day that my gf was 25 weeks pregnant! GF rang HMRC and it turns out that the Midwife has our due date as 16th July (whereas the hospital consultant has it as 15th July). Basically they said no because it was signed ONE DAY early.
